Mountain Silverbell

Halesia monticola

  • Upright, spreading oval to vase-shaped crown
  • White bell-shaped blooms
  • Flowers occur along the previous season's branches
  • Flowers are hidden by the dark green foliage
  • Yellow fall colour
  • Pale yellow fruit
  • Bloom Time: May to June

Growing and Maintenance Tips:


Plant in a well-drained, acidic soil with some shelter from winter winds.
